引言

          随着虚拟币市场的迅猛发展,越来越多的人开始关注数字资产的投资与应用。其中,钱包的作用不可小觑。虚拟币钱包服务器承载着用户资产的安全和交易的高效性。在这篇文章中,我们将深入探讨虚拟币对接钱包服务器的架构、功能以及在区块链生态中的重要性。

          一、虚拟币钱包服务器的基本概念

          虚拟币钱包是用户存储和管理其数字资产的工具,它不仅可以用来接收和发送虚拟币,还可以查询交易记录、管理多种资产等。为了实现这一功能,钱包服务器扮演着至关重要的角色。

          • 钱包服务器的定义:钱包服务器是提供虚拟币管理、交易处理等功能的后台服务,其主要任务是确保用户的资产安全,并提供便捷的交易服务。
          • 服务器架构:一般来说,钱包服务器可以分为热钱包和冷钱包。热钱包与互联网连接,可以随时进行交易;冷钱包则不与互联网连接,适合长期保存资产。

          二、虚拟币钱包服务器的核心功能

          虚拟币钱包服务器的功能不仅限于存储和转账,其核心功能包括:

          • 资产管理:用户可以在钱包服务器上查看自己的资产情况,包括各类虚拟币的余额。
          • 交易处理:钱包服务器需要能够快速、准确地处理用户的交易请求,确保交易的及时性。
          • 安全保护:通过多重签名、加密技术等手段,确保用户资产的安全。
          • 数据分析:钱包服务器可以进行数据分析,帮助用户了解市场动态。

          三、钱包服务器的架构设计

          在设计一个高效、安全的虚拟币钱包服务器时,应考虑到以下几个方面:

          1. 服务架构

          钱包服务器的服务架构一般采用分层设计,包括前端展示层、后台逻辑层和数据服务层。这样的设计使得系统更加灵活,便于扩展。

          2. 数据库设计

          虚拟币钱包需要存储大量的数据,包括用户信息、交易记录等。在数据库设计上,应考虑数据的安全性和访问效率,常用的数据库有关系型数据库和非关系型数据库。

          3. API接口

          钱包服务器应提供稳定且高效的API接口,以便于与其他系统集成(如交易所、支付系统等),支持各种编程语言的调用。

          4. 安全机制

          为了保证用户资产的安全,钱包服务器应采用多种安全机制,如SSL加密、DDoS防护、身份验证等。

          四、虚拟币钱包服务器的应用场景

          随着区块链技术的不断发展,虚拟币钱包服务器的应用场景也越来越广泛。这些应用场景主要包括:

          • 个人钱包:用户可以通过钱包服务器管理自己的虚拟资产,进行购买、出售等操作。
          • 商户支付:越来越多的商户开始支持虚拟币支付,钱包服务器在这其中起着重要的桥梁作用。
          • 交易所:交易所需要与钱包服务器对接,为用户提供安全、快捷的兑换服务。
          • 金融服务:一些金融机构开始提供基于虚拟币的金融服务,如借贷、投资等。

          五、常见问题解析

          1. 如何选择合适的虚拟币钱包服务器?

          在选择虚拟币钱包服务器时,需要考虑多方面的因素:

          • 安全性:安全是选择钱包服务器的首要考虑因素。应该优先选择具备高安全性措施(如多重签名、冷钱包等)的服务器。
          • 支持的币种:不同的钱包服务器支持的币种各不相同,用户应根据自己的需求选择。
          • 用户体验:界面友好、操作简单是提高用户体验的关键,选择一款用户体验良好的钱包可以帮助用户快速上手。
          • 技术支持:如果用户对区块链技术不够了解,建议选择提供完善技术支持的服务商,以便在遇到问题时能及时解决。

          2. 如何确保虚拟币交易的安全性?

          保护虚拟币交易安全的方法主要包括:

          • 选择可靠的平台:在进行交易时,优先选择通过审核并获得良好评价的交易所或钱包。
          • 启用双重身份验证:不少钱包服务支持双重身份验证,增加额外的安全防护。
          • 定期更新密码:定期更换密码、启用复杂密码,能有效降低黑客攻击的风险。
          • 保持软件更新:确保使用的软硬件始终是最新版本,及时更新可以修补已知的安全漏洞。

          3. 虚拟币钱包的种类有哪些?

          虚拟币钱包主要分为以下几类:

          • 热钱包:适合频繁交易的用户,操作便捷,但安全性相对较低。
          • 冷钱包:更适合长期保存资产,安全性高,例如硬件钱包或纸质钱包。
          • 在线钱包:用户通过互联网访问的钱包,方便快捷。
          • 桌面钱包:需要下载软件安装在本地,安全性相对较高,但不如冷钱包安全。

          4. 钱包服务器的搭建过程是怎样的?

          搭建钱包服务器的过程主要包括:

          • 需求分析:明确需要支持的虚拟币种类、交易量预估等。
          • 架构设计:选择适合的服务架构、数据库以及安全方案。
          • 开发与测试:按照设计方案进行开发,边开发边进行测试以确保每一环节都能正常运行。
          • 上线与维护:上线后需定期进行监控和维护,确保系统的稳定性。

          5. 区块链技术如何与钱包服务器结合?

          区块链技术是支撑虚拟币的一项革命性技术,与钱包服务器的结合影响着虚拟币的功能和发展:

          • 去中心化:区块链技术的去中心化特性使得虚拟币交易更加透明和安全,钱包服务器基于此构建。
          • 透明性:所有交易信息都记录在链上,可以被任意人随时查看。
          • 智能合约:未来钱包服务器可以集成智能合约功能,实现自动化交易。

          总结

          虚拟币对接钱包服务器在数字货币的生态系统中起着不可或缺的角色。它不仅影响着用户资产的安全性,还直接关系到区块链技术的健康发展。通过不断完善钱包服务器的架构、功能和安全性,才能更好地服务于日益增长的虚拟币用户群体。希望本文的深入分析能为相关从业者和用户提供帮助,理解虚拟币钱包服务器的诸多重要方面。